False Leaf Tree Extract stands apart from synthetic chemicals because no two crops look precisely the same. Drought, soil composition, timing of harvest—all reshape the chemical profile. Our operation learned through trial and error: a heavy rain year raised water content in raw leaves, requiring us to adjust evaporation parameters or risk dilute extracts that let mold sneak in. A colder harvest pulled down sugar levels, which in turn shifted extraction yields. We mapped these patterns across several seasons, feeding insights back into sourcing plans and refining extraction recipes.
